Ciao Cafe. Interesting name to start. Hi cafe....anywho, interior decor is no different from the previous few cafes to rent this space. I'd almost go as far as to say all the seating came with it. I don't get why the decor around here is lacking.

Plus, it was dirty. When we walked in there was only 1 couple seated and the single employee was doing nothing. After getting our order and going to sit I noticed hair on 1 table & food stuck to another. So hard to find good help!

They specialize in gelato which is cool. We have lots of ice cream around here but with my sensitive stomach I can't do a lot of it. Plus, affogato! However they are pricy. I considered offering affogatos in my cafe but wouldn't have come close to $6.50 a drink. Looking at their menu it's the full cost of their small gelato plus their dopio. You'd think they'd have a small discount. Like an al la cart menu. *shrug* One more rhing I'll have over the others.
